Maybe he's ready to talk. Source: OpenSubtitles开口是银,沉默是金。 kāikǒu shì yín, chénmò shì jīn. Speech is silver, silence is gold. Source: Tatoeba他沉默良久,终于开口了。 tā chénmò liángjiǔ, zhōngyú kāikǒu le. He was silent for a long time before he finally spoke.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ary你是唯一能让他开口的人。 nǐ shì wéiyī néng ràng tā kāikǒu de rén. You're the only one who can get him to talk. Source: OpenSubtitles我会让他开口的。 wǒ huì ràng tā kāikǒu de. I'll get him to talk. Source: OpenSubtitles她一直不开口。 tā yīzhí bù kāikǒu. She never spoke. Source: OpenSubtitles你让她开口了? nǐ ràng tā kāikǒu le? You got her to talk? Source: OpenSubtitles他犹豫了很久,终于开口说话了。 tā yóuyù le hěn jiǔ, zhōngyú kāikǒu shuōhuà le. He hesitated for a long time before finally speaking up.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ary他一开口,我就听出了他的话音。 tā yī kāikǒu, wǒ jiù tīngchū le tā de huàyīn. As soon as he spoke, I recognized his voice.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ary他会开口的。 tā huì kāikǒu de. He will talk. Source: OpenSubtitles我想城堡里不会再有人开口说话了。 wǒ xiǎng chéngbǎo lǐ bù huì zài yǒu rén kāikǒu shuōhuà le. I don't think anybody in that castle would ever talk again. Source: OpenSubtitles你现在要做的就是开口告诉我真相。 nǐ xiànzài yào zuò de jiù shì kāikǒu gàosu wǒ zhēnxiàng. What you need to do right now is start telling me the truth. Source: OpenSubtitles我也是出于不得已,才开口向你借钱的。 wǒ yě shì chūyú bùdéyǐ, cái kāikǒu xiàng nǐ jièqián de. I only asked to borrow money from you because I had no other choice.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ary他犹豫了很久,才好意思开口向朋友借钱。 tā yóuyù le hěn jiǔ, cái hǎoyìsi kāikǒu xiàng péngyou jièqián. He hesitated for a long time before he felt comfortable asking his friend for money.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ary你小时候从来都无法开口谈自己的感受。 nǐ xiǎoshíhou cónglái dōu wúfǎ kāikǒu tán zìjǐ de gǎnshòu. When you were little you could never talk about your feelings. Source: OpenSubtitles医生叫病人开口,好检查喉咙。 yīshēng jiào bìngrén kāikǒu, hǎo jiǎnchá hóulóng. The doctor asked the patient to open their mouth so he could check their throat. Source: Dong Chinese Dictionary
